Specific Phobia
An intense, irrational fear of, or aversion to, specific objects or situations.
Behavior Therapy
A type of psychotherapy that focuses on changing undesirable behaviors through conditioning techniques, without necessarily seeking insights into their causes.
Gestalt Therapy
A form of psychotherapy that emphasizes personal responsibility and focuses on the individual's experience in the present moment, the therapist-client relationship, the environmental and social contexts of a person's life, and the self-regulating adjustments people make as a result of their overall situation.
